After the inspection work in Liangxi City was completed, Nie Zhenbang and his team immediately traveled to other parts of Jiangbei Province.
At the same time, a series of actions in Liangxi City caused quite a stir in the Jiangbei officialdom. The rise of Nie’s faction in Liangxi City was strong. Additionally, Fan Changsheng and Nie’s faction became close, it was clear to everyone that from then on, Liangxi City was truly under Nie’s control.
When Nie Zhenbang’s team left Jiangbei Province, Chen Le, the Deputy Mayor of Liangxi City and Director of the City Public Security Bureau, was transferred to Yuzhou Province to serve as the Executive Deputy Director of the Provincial Public Security Department.
At the same time, Fan Lei, Deputy Director of the Liangjiang District People’s Government, completed a one-month training course at the Provincial Party School. However, Fan Lei did not return to his original unit, but was directly transferred to Pengcheng City to serve as a standing member of the Dongpeng District Committee, Deputy Secretary of the District Committee, and Acting District Mayor of Dongpeng District People’s Government.
Over the next few months, they completed inspections of Yanbei Province, Ludong Province, Heishui Province, and Yuzhou Province. Time had passed from the beginning of the year when the San Gong office was established to November.
During this period, the San Gong office staff naturally had some rest time. Basically, after inspecting a province, they would return to Jingcheng for about a week of rest. This rest was necessary. It was unrealistic to expect non-stop inspections. Not to mention whether the people could endure it. Considering that all the staff had families back in Jingcheng, it was impossible not to rest. After all, who didn’t have some personal business to attend to?

During this time, the San Gong office, with its five groups, had completed more than half of the inspection work, and the overall results were quite satisfactory. According to statistics from the National Audit Department, after implementing the San Gong regulations, the nationwide reduction in San Gong expenditure each year reached 620 billion. At the same time, the quantifiable results increased the people’s trust in the Party and the government.
The inspections by the San Gong office also discovered many problems. After these were announced in the newspaper media, the responsible persons and officials were duly punished. Overall, the implementation of the San Gong regulations was quite satisfactory for now. This was highly praised by Director Shen.
In the meantime, an unexpected event happened: in Bashu Province, Nie Guowei, the Old Man, was suddenly transferred by the Central Organization Department to serve as a State Councilor in the State Council.
Presumably, this was Director Shen and fellow leader’s affirmation and recognition of his work. Clearly, this was preparing the Old Man to serve as Deputy Leader in the next term.

The weather in November had already entered deep winter. An Eastern Airlines Boeing 747 began to descend, piercing through the clouds. As the altitude gradually decreased, the scenery on the ground slowly came into view. This time, the destination of Nie Zhenbang and his team was Liaodong Province.
The ground was covered in white snow, showcasing a splendid northern scenery. The plane slowly landed at Shenjing International Airport in Liaodong Province.
Upon their exit, they saw a striking sight at the airport exit: a large Jinlong business vehicle parked prominently, while a few men in dark wool coats were heading towards Nie Zhenbang.
The leader was about fifty-five or fifty-six years old, his hair was receded up his forehead, and he was very tall. This was characteristic of people from the north, especially Liaodong, where everyone was tall.

“Director Nie, welcome. Allow me to introduce myself, I am Shi Jianshe. Our Secretary Huo originally planned to come in person, but he had an unexpected foreign affairs event and couldn’t make it. He specially asked me to welcome Director Nie.” The man extended his hand and greeted Nie Zhenbang warmly.
Since they came to Liaodong, Nie Zhenbang already had a certain understanding and research of the personnel structure of the Liaodong Provincial Committee.
This Shi Jianshe was a Standing Member of the Liaodong Provincial Committee and the Secretary-General of the Provincial Committee. The Secretary Huo mentioned by Shi Jianshe was Huo Siyuan, the Secretary of the Liaodong Provincial Committee.
No matter whether Huo Siyuan really had business or not, at least he had made his attitude clear. Even more so, he had organized Shi Jianshe to meet Nie’s group. Naturally, Nie Zhenbang couldn’t find any reason to question this. What’s more, Nie Zhenbang was never fond of these formalities.
Then, with a smile, he said: “Secretary-General Shi, you’re too polite. Please convey my thanks to Secretary Huo. Secretary-General Shi, I think it’s best we leave the airport now.”
Nie Zhenbang’s words stunned Shi Jianshe for a moment, then he smacked his head and laughed: “Yes, yes, you see how forgetful I am. Director Nie, this way please.”
After the San Gong office team boarded the Jinlong business vehicle, Nie Zhenbang sat in the car in front with Shi Jianshe.
The car was an old Audi model. This was also a purchase made before the implementation of the San Gong regulations, so it was not against the rules to use it now. In China, Audi and Mercedes-Benz official cars are the most common official vehicles in various places. Such a situation would probably only change after five years of implementing the San Gong regulations.
Two vehicles, one leading the other, left the airport and headed directly toward the Liaodong Provincial Committee Guesthouse.
At this moment, inside the Liaodong Provincial Committee Office Building. The office block of the Liaodong Provincial Committee’s main complex wasn’t particularly tall, but it occupied a large area of land.
In an office on the seventh floor of the main building, the office was a spacious 200 square meters. Next to the oversized desk, there was a set of black leather couches.
The heating in the room was cranked high. Sitting on the sofas were two elderly men around sixty years old, enjoying their tea. The slightly leaner of the two looked at the authoritative figure sitting across from him and said with a laugh, “Secretary Huo, this year, the Ministry of Public Affairs and Nie Zhenbang have become the most famous people and events in the country. He is Director Shen’s favorite, the newcomer the Gang has been promoting since Mu Dingjian. Aren’t you going to welcome him?”
As the Secretary of the Liaodong Provincial Committee and also a Central Committee member, Huo Siyuan naturally possessed an air of authority and grandeur.
Huo Siyuan sneered inwardly at Cao Dingkun’s obvious ploy to probe his attitude before responding with a smile, “Governor Cao, as for this inspection of the Ministry of Public Affairs, my view is to make it grand without flattering. To show respect without causing distractions. If I show up, it would only make Comrade Nie Zhenbang feel uncomfortable. It’s best to avoid that.”
Cao Dingkun, the Deputy Secretary of the Liaodong Provincial Committee and Governor of the Provincial People’s Government. The mutual testing between them at this moment was a reflection of the unwritten rule in the officialdom: the relationship between the party committee and the government is never truly harmonious.
Cursing Huo Siyuan as an old fox in his heart, Cao Dingkun criticized his statement as pure lip service. What does “grand but not flattering”, “respectful but not distracting” even mean? In essence, he hasn’t said anything of substance. However, Cao Dingkun understood that getting any useful information out of Huo Siyuan was going to be impossible.
Changing the subject, Cao Dingkun looked at Huo Siyuan and said, “Secretary Huo, what I mean is, in honor of Comrade Nie Zhenbang’s arrival, should we host a reception in the name of the Provincial Committee and the Provincial Government to indicate our intentions?”
Huo Siyuan then looked at Cao Dingkun indifferently. What was Cao Dingkun up to? Did he want to stir up the situation in Liaodong Province by using Nie Zhenbang’s arrival? Did he think of himself as Shen Yanshuo now?
True, Shen Yanshuo’s rank in the party was one level higher than his. He was, after all, a member of the Politburo. However, Huo Siyuan had ample confidence in himself. The situation in Liaodong was different from that in Jiangbei. Nie Zhenbang had a foundation in Jiangbei, but as far as Liaodong was concerned, he didn’t have the slightest connection. Stirring things up wouldn’t be an easy task.
After mulling it over, Huo Siyuan spoke slowly, “If Governor Dingkun insists on it, then holding a welcome reception isn’t out of the question. However, I suggest not to expand the scale. Holding it at the level of the Standing Committee would be most suitable. What do you think?”
When he referred to the ‘level of the Standing Committee’, it meant that they would only invite Nie Zhenbang from the Ministry of Public Affairs. It would be a kind of high-level exchange between deputy department-level figures.
Seeing Huo Siyuan setting the tone, Cao Dingkun no longer had anything to say and nodded with a smile, “Since Secretary Huo agreed, I’ll start arranging.”
As the two top officials of Liaodong Province were discussing, Nie Zhenbang and his party had already arrived at the Liaodong Provincial Committee Guesthouse. At this time, a large red banner warmly welcoming the leaders of the Ministry of Public Affairs to inspect and guide the work in our province was already hanging at the guesthouse entrance.
The rooms for Nie Zhenbang and the others were arranged on the fifth floor of the guesthouse. There were elevators in the lobby that led directly up. There were eight rooms in total. Ten staff members occupied one of the rooms. Each pair shared a double room. Besides that, Huang Xudong, Li Jupeng, and Nie Zhenbang were each allocated a single room.
Nie Zhenbang’s single room was a suite. From this, one could see that the Liaodong Provincial Committee had indeed put thought into their arrangements. After they had put down their luggage, Nie Zhenbang picked up the phone and dialed a number. The call was quickly answered, and a surprised voice came over, “Mayor, you’ve arrived? I’m already in Shenjing. Shall I come to pick you up?”
The voice belonged to Lin Mohan. Before they set off, Nie Zhenbang had already informed Lin Mohan, who had hurried over from Gangcheng City.
Nie Zhenbang chuckled, “Mohan, no need to trouble yourself. I’ve arrived at the Liaodong Provincial Committee Guesthouse. We were picked up at the airport by Comrade Shi Jianshe from the Liaodong Provincial Committee. You can come directly. I’m in room 501.”
Hearing Nie Zhenbang’s words, Lin Mohan’s voice was filled with surprise on the other end, “So soon? Great, I’m on my way.”
Lin Mohan didn’t lie. Within five minutes, the sounds of him chatting and laughing with Li Jupeng could be heard outside the door. Shortly after, the doorbell rang.
